Renormgroup symmetries in problems of nonlinear geometrical optics

V. F. Kovalev

Institute for Mathematical Modelling, Russian Academy of Sciences

Abstract: Renormgroup symmetries for a boundary value problem for the system of equations which describes propagation of a powerful radiation in a nonlinear medium in geometrical optics approximation are constructed. With the help of renormgroup symmetries new exact and approximate analytical solutions of nonlinear geometrical optics equations are obtained. Explicit analytical expressions are presented that characterize spatial evolution of a laser beam which has an arbitrary intensity dependence at the boundary of the nonlinear medium.
